Next-gen PSP in shops for Christmas

More like the iPhone than the current model


7 April 2009 11:55 GMT / By Amy-Mae Elliott

Sony's next-gen PlayStation portable handheld console will be on shop shelves in time for Christmas, according to a new report.

An "insider source", said to be "a developer working on the new hardware", has told PocketGamer that the new gaming gadget will "be far more similar to the iPhone than the current device".

The source says the PSP 2 will be a compact device with a large touchscreen that will slide open to reveal buttons, D-pads and dual analogue controls.

This dual format will mean Sony can go after the casual gaming market with the touchscreen side of things, a market the iPhone and iPod touch have done very well in, while more "serious" gamers are still taken care of.

More details are said to be due to be unveiled at the E3 gaming event in June - we will keep you posted.
